During her 20 years with the WNBA, Sue Bird says she’s seen players engage more on social issues, like BLM, and that the league has “embraced who we are.” Bird says such “authenticity” also meant going public with her relationship with soccer star Megan Rapinoe. "60 Minutes" is the most successful television broadcast in history. Offering hard-hitting investigative reports, interviews, feature segments and profiles of people in the news, the broadcast began in 1968 and is still a hit, over 50 seasons later, regularly making Nielsen's Top 10.
